Banks' risk-weighted assets reached ARS 61.8 bil in 2020 in Argentina, according to the National Central Bank. This is 43.6% more than in the previous year.
Historically, banks' risk-weighted assets in Argentina reached an all time high of ARS 61.8 bil in 2020 and an all time low of ARS 1.46 bil in 2005.
Argentina has been ranked 75th within the group of 87 countries we follow in terms of banks' risk-weighted assets.
